2017-04-21 80 views
0

我想寫一個excel返回值的if語句。如果Excel語句沒有返回正確的值

下面是示例

我想總結行的範圍說A1:A25和如果總和B1的值:B25小於A1:A25返回條件爲真,如果不進行計算。

= IF(G7:AT7> G8:AQ8,0, 「 - 0.1 *(SUM(Y14:AL14))+ SUM(AO14:AQ14」)

上方是我的條件,但將Excel返回「值」

可以在這裏的任何一個幫助如何解決這個公式

回答

1

你有幾個語法errors.The公式應該是:

= IF(SUM(B1:B25) < SUM(A1:A25) , true , -0.1 * (SUM(Y14:AL14) + SUM(AO14:AQ14))) 
0
  1. 您在使用不同的範圍文本和公式。讓它匹配。
  2. 您需要先計算總和才能比較。如果你只是在其他細胞中一步一步地做事,那麼一開始可能會更容易。

根據文本應該是:

=IF(SUM(B1:B25)>SUM(A1:A25);TRUE();"other calculation") 

更多的監督,你首先做不同的細胞總和得到...

[C1]=SUM(A1:A25) 
[D1]=SUM(B1:B25) 
[E1]=-0.1*SUM(Y14:AL14;AO14:AQ14) 
[F1]=IF(D1<C1,TRUE(),E1) 

萬物後,可以作爲你liek它,你仍然可以合併,清理並使其看起來不錯。